Transaction 3a9107fafddeaf7ea6937f77e782ddebc003bc5fe26d4d06c2de2fe554da8145

2 Input
2 Outputs
  • 3a9107fafddeaf7ea6937f77e782ddebc003bc5fe26d4d06c2de2fe554da8145:0
  • value  110644098
    address  162mcmxjWhT2VAAo2XeCysoe4uMaZohAZ7
  • 3a9107fafddeaf7ea6937f77e782ddebc003bc5fe26d4d06c2de2fe554da8145:1
  • value  50079
    address  19XxEPMtQCQPzDJyCvkyXkMYFRax3tXNRK